Gina Marano is a PhD student in Forest Ecology at ETH Zurich. Her research work focuses on developing alternative formulations of soil water dynamics to better represent drought impacts on long-term forest dynamics, in particular on stand growth and biomass production, species competition/composition and mortality over the Forest Gap model ForClim developed by Prof. Harald Bugmann at ETH Zürich.

Within the Forest Modelling group she focused on:

-studying and assessing of soil physical processes in the 3D-CMCC-FEM model

-testing the 3D-CMCC-FEM model by simulating different silvicultural interventions under  climate change scenarios.

In her past work at the University of Napoli Federico II she provided scientific support for the development of informatic tools over a geoSpatial Decision Support Systems to support Sustainable Forest Management practices at the local scales (LANDSUPPORT Horizon 2020).

 

She is the responsible for the communication of the Forest Modelling Working Group of the Italian Society of Silviculture and Forest Ecology (SISEF).
